The Lancaster Police Department Internship Program is reserved for current University or College students with a (preferred) major of concentration in the criminal justice field. The objective of the Student Internship Program is to provide a positive learning environment for interested University or College students to experience all aspects and responsibilities of law enforcement while completing a project as part of their studies.
